Day 01: Arrive Hanoi.
Upon arrival at Noibai airport in Hanoi, you will be greeted by Lotussia Travel guide, driver and transferred to your hotel in town.
Check-in hotel (after 14:00) and stay free for the rest of time.
Overnight in Hanoi (Hotel).
Day 02: Hanoi full day sightseeing tour (B)
Enjoy a full day sightseeing tour of Hanoi, a unique city with tree-lined boulevards, French colonial architecture, peaceful lakes and oriental temples. The city tour includes such sights as the Ho Chi Minh stilts house, One Pillar Pagoda and the Temple of Literature – The first National University of Vietnam.
In the afternoon, continue visiting the Ethnology museum where you can find the biggest object collection of 54 Vietnamese ethnic groups.
Enjoy a short cyclo excursion through the bustling old quarter streets named after the specific goods once offered for sales at these places.
In the evening, attend to the water puppet show, one of famous Vietnamese traditional art.
Overnight in Hanoi (Hotel).
Day 03: Hanoi – Ha Giang (B,L,D)
Transfer to Ha Giang though Son Nam District of Tuyen Quang province. Enjoy natural landscape and green fields, palm hill and villages along the way. Lunch will be provided in a local restaurant en route. Passing Tuyen quang town, you can visit village of black Tay minority. Arrive Ha Giang town in late afternoon.
Dinner and overnight in a stilt-house in a Tay village (Homestay).
Day 04: Ha Giang – Quan Ba – Yen Minh (B,L,D).
After breakfast in the stilt-house of the Tay, we will spend about one hour for visiting Ha Giang museum where you can find the most updated object collection of 23 ethnic minorities living in the province.
Leaving Ha Giang, we will travel to Quan Ba. Stop en route to visit a Hmong village which is well known the their traditional recipe of making corn wine. Lunch will be served in a local restaurant in town. After lunch we will visit a Dao village before continuing our drive to Yen Minh.
Arrive in Yen Minh around late afternoon. If time permits, we will have a short walk to a local village where three ethnic groups Tay, Nung & Giay live together.
Overnight in Yen Minh (Guesthouse).
Day 05: Yen Minh – Dong Van – Meo Vac (B,L,D)
Depart for Dong Van. Stop en route to visit a H’mong village and the Palace of the Vuong family (The King of H’mong people). Lunch will be provided in a local restaurant in Dong Van. After lunch, we will visit the ancient town of Dong Van before continuing our trip to Meo Vac. Enjoy great view over the Nho Que river once reaching Ma Pi Leng pass.
Arrive Meo Vac around late afternoon. Check-in hotel for overnight.
Day 06: Meo Vac – Bao Lac (B,L,D)
Note: This day must be Sunday
Enjoy the whole morning for the market of Meo Vac, opens every Sunday has become very famous for their uniqueness as markets and also sites for cultural exchange of ethnic minority groups.
Lunch will be provided in a local restaurant in town. After lunch, we will leave Meo Vac for Bao Lac.
Overnight in Bao Lac (Guesthouse).
Day 07: Bao Lac – Ba Be Lake (B,L,D)
After breakfast, enjoy a nice journey from Bao Lac to Ba Be. Few passes from where you can dominate the area. The road is quite easy but there are also many curves. We can stop en route to visit some local hill tribe villages. Arrive Ba Be lake around late afternoon.
Overnight in a stilt-house in a Tay village (Homestay).
Day 08: Ba Be Lake – Hanoi (B,L)
After breakfast, enjoy a 4-hour boat trip on Ba Be lake. We will visit the Puong grottoes before disembarking in a small pier. Join our vehicle again for a short drive to Ba Be town. Have lunch in a local restaurant. Then return Hanoi.
Arrive Hanoi around late afternoon. We will check-in hotel for a short rest. Then enjoy one-hour massage package to one of the finest spa saloon in Hanoi – A full body massage both invigorating and relaxing. This massage helps to reduce tension, soothe sore muscles and increase circulation.
Overnight in Hanoi (Hotel).
Extension
Day 09: Hanoi – Halong Bay (B,L,D)
Enjoy the journey through the rich farmlands of the Red River Delta and the scenery of rice fields, water buffalo and everyday Vietnamese village life. Arrive in Halong and board the Bai Tho traditional sailing junk (or similar). Whilst cruising the exquisite waters sample the regions fresh seafood. Visit the recently discovered Surprise Grotto with its great views, and on the next island see the yawning mouth of Bo Nau Cave. In the afternoon, enjoy one-hour kayaking trip to explore further “The 8th World Wonder”. Watch the sunset over the bay whilst enjoying a delicious dinner.
Overnight on board junk (Boat-house).
Day 10: Halong Bay – Hanoi (B)
Breakfast will be provided on board. Then we continue our cruise in Halong bay while the boat is going back to shore. Arrive at Ha long wharf about 11h00 and take our car for our journey back to Hanoi.
Day 11: Departure.
Free until transfer directly to Noibai airport for onward flight home. End trip.
